Handover for the Quillmark date-localization work, for your release planning. All user-facing dates now route through the Calenda formatting layer; hardcoded patterns were removed from the Ledgerview and Inbox modules, but three legacy reports in Archivist still bypass it — tracked and slated for the next minor. Locale bundles ship separately, so a release is not blocked on translation freeze. Rollout order, the remaining exceptions, and verification steps are listed on the internal page here:

wiki page, tahaf-tajog: https://jira.ordindyn.corp/pipeline

**v5.1.0 — Setting renamed (heads up, on-call!)**

The Stockwhistle inventory reconciliation job no longer reads `RECON_SECRET` — it got renamed to `INVENTORY_SYNC_TOKEN` because two teams kept confusing it with the reporting key. The nightly job will skip silently if only the old name is set (sorry). Before tonight's run, make sure each worker's env file includes the following line.

sealed setting: VAULT_KEY20=69e2a0b23f1a79fbf692

// REINDEX_BATCH_CAP limits docs per shard pass in the Tallowfield
// nightly search reindex. Raising it starves the ingest queue;
// lowering it overruns the maintenance window. 5000 is the tested
// sweet spot. Change only with a soak run. Verified against the
// build noted below.

session token of bawif-hahog = htk6_ac5981

Hey plugin authors!

Before your PulseCrate plugin ships telemetry, squeeze it down. Our collector expects payloads gzipped and under 64KB — anything bigger gets dropped silently, which is a fun way to lose a week debugging. Batch your events, compress once per flush, and set the encoding header so the collector knows what it's getting. If you want to sanity-check what actually landed, you can query the ingest staging table directly in the sandbox environment using the connection string below:

replica DSN, kajep-yahag: mssql://praok_svc:iF@db-8d68.plorvaio.local:5432/eliion